The Mouse House is expanding, with Disney combining its Hulu + Live TV business with Fubo, but the streaming TV deal may be about way more than settling a legal battle over Venu Sports.
Today, Disney announced its deal to combine its Hulu + Live TV business with Fubo, creating a combined virtual multichannel video programming distributor (MVPD) company. With the deal, Disney becomes the majority owner of the resulting company, controlling 70% of Fubo. This new combined business is operating under Fubo’s existing management team and the Fubo name, and Fubo and Hulu + Live TV will continue to be available to consumers as separate offerings.
